Responsibilities
Strategic Procurement & Planning
- Develop and implement procurement strategies to support production, project timelines, and business objectives.
- Forecast purchasing needs based on sales, project pipelines, and inventory levels.
Supplier Management
- Source, evaluate, and select suppliers based on quality, pricing, delivery performance, and compliance.
- Negotiate contracts, pricing agreements, and credit terms to achieve favourable outcomes.
- Monitor supplier performance (quality, delivery, responsiveness) and drive continuous improvement.
Purchasing Operations
- Guide a team of buyers to execute the purchasing function.
- Manage, guide and mentor the purchasing team.
- Oversee RFQ, PO issuance, order tracking, delivery scheduling, and shipment coordination.
- Ensure materials and components are delivered on time to support operational and project requirements.
- Resolve supply delays, quality issues, and discrepancies in collaboration with suppliers and internal teams.
- Assist in the collection and reporting of market analysis, commodity trends, cost trends.
Inventory, Cost & Compliance
- Work closely with warehouse and planning teams to maintain optimal stock levels while reducing excess and obsolescence.
- Manage procurement budgets, cost analysis, and monthly reporting.
- Ensure compliance with company policies, ISO standards, and regulatory requirements.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Support NPI (New Product Introduction) sourcing for new components and materials.
- Support special projects as needed and required.
- Participate in audits, supplier evaluations, and process improvement initiatives.
Requirements
- Bachelor's Degree in Supply Chain, Business, Engineering, or a related field.
- Minimum 7 years of procurement experience, preferably in manufacturing, commodities, engineering, or logistics sectors.
- Strong negotiation, vendor management, and contract management skills.
- Proficient in ERP/MRP systems (SAP) and Excel.
- Strong analytical, communication, and problem-solving abilities.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
- Able to lead a team.
- Flexibility as sometimes require early morning or evening phone calls with global team member.
